Daily Prediction of Electricity Rates of Distribution Utilities in Luzon

Abstract

Objectives: The main objective of this study is to develop a best model that will forecast the electricity rates of distribution utilities in Luzon. Methods/Statistical Analysis: The secondary data of price, demand and supply of electricity of distribution utilities per region in Luzon from January 2015 to March 2017 that was used in the study were gathered from MERALCO that were obtained from the official website of Wholesale Electricity Spot Market (WESM). The data were analysed by the use of statistical software such as EViews7 and MATLAB. Findings: The data were analyzed by the use of statistical software such as EViews7 and MATLAB. The models used for forecasting the participants’ electric demand is ARIMA (1, 1, 1) for CAR, Region 1, Region 2, Region 3, Region 4B and Region 5. The models for forecasting the supply of electricity are: ARIMA (2, 1, 2) for CAR, ARIMA (3, 1, 1) for NCR and Region 1, ARIMA (3, 1, 2) for Region 2, ARIMA (1, 1, 1) for Region 3 and ARIMA (2, 1, 1) for Region 4A and Region 5. The forecasted demand of electricity of distribution utilities in every region for years 2017-2019 will continue to increase. The forecasted electric supply of distribution utilities in every region for years 2017-2019 will go through an increase and decrease from time to time but still trending upwards. Additionally, it was also shown that there were no significant differences between the actual and forecasted values. Application/Improvements: Using the model electricity demand and supply rates of distribution utilities in Luzon were forecasted for the next two years.
